Let G k , n ℂ for 2 ≤ k < n denote the Grassmann manifold of k -dimensional vector subspaces of ℂ n . In this paper, we compute, in terms of the Sullivan models, the rational evaluation subgroups and, more generally, the G -sequence of the inclusion G 2 , n ℂ ↣ G 2 , n + r ℂ for r ≥ 1 .

In a recent development, wetting transition is considered in the dynamics approach in which the wetting problem of the Sullivan model is equivalent to a classical particle moving in a force field. This article reviews this recent development for modeled solid-fluid interfaces and phase transitions in confined fluids. A simple dynamics approach within van der Waals framework is formulated and applied to various wetting problems which are transformed into problems in classical dynamics. Emphasis is placed on the order of the transitions.
